    Do you know a family with a child who has an ongoing health condition? Tombolo wants to help!

    Welcome to Tombolo, an emerging nonprofit in the twin cities! We are non-judgmental, non-partisan, have no religions affiliation. We quite simply want to help families connect with their support network to better meet their various needs. The demands on families are many and when a child has a chronic health condition, the demands can sometimes seem unmanageable. Our mission is to help families of children with ongoing health conditions by connecting them to high quality community resources, mobilizing their existing support networks and providing volunteers to address their unmet needs.

    As the mother of a child with a rare disease, I have learned first hand that it can be challenging to ask for the help we need, and to accept help when offered.   So I co-founded Tombolo where we strive to make this part of disease management easier for families.

    We are recruiting our first cohort of 10 families to our Community Connect program, a free online support network for families who have one of more child with ongoing health condition. Think Caring Bridge + PayPal + Event Planner. Our support network, hosted through Zanby, allows families to create a site and post journal entries, photos, accepts donations, and use a calendar feature to ask friends and families for help with specific events such as rides, babysitting, grocery shopping and more. The family’s site can be as private or public as the family chooses and can interface with Facebook. We welcome families from around the world to participate in this program.
